The transcript discusses the current economic rates, specifically the five to five and a quarter percent rate, and whether it is sufficiently restrictive. It emphasizes the need for ongoing assessment and data accumulation to determine the appropriateness of this rate. The March meeting's economic projections indicated that this rate might be suitable, but further evaluation will occur in the June meeting.
